[SOLVED]Hanging after booting from installation media

Yesterday I booted from a rw-DVD got to the terminal and could execute commands, connect to the internet and use elink etc no problem. I didn't go through with installation as I wanted to read up more on partitioning my drives for dual booting before actually doing so.

Trying the same thing today, and it hangs soon after I boot, regardless of whether I do anything. Printing the following:

nouveau E[      DRM] failed to idle channel 0xcccc0000 [DRM]
pci_pm_runtime_suspend(): nouveau_pmops_runtime_suspend+0x0/0xf0 [nouveau] returns -16
INFO: rcu_preempt detected stalls on CPUs/tasks: { 6} (detected by 1, t=18002 jiffiess, g=974, c=973, q=604)

This is without me typing anything. If I try to execute a command quickly after booting it sometimes works, but after a couple of minutes it will complain of a soft lockup.

I've tried burning another disk, and using a USB installation media, but the same thing happens. Any thoughts?

Edit: Trying to run it on a laptop with i7-4700MQ, 16GB ram, and Intel(R) HD Graphics 4600 / NVIDIA GeForce GTX 770M

Second Edit: Booted with nomodeset, which worked and allowed me to install. Just trying to sort out the sodding boot loaders now...
